New Delhi [India], March 12 (ANI): Prime Minister Narendra Modi on Wednesday extended his greetings to the people of Haryana as the Bharatiya Janata Party (BJP) sweeps the elections to local bodies, saying that this victory was an expression of the “unwavering faith of people” in development works being carried out by the Nayab Singh Saini government in the state.
“I am very grateful to my family members in Haryana for the historic victory of BJP in the Haryana civic elections,” PM Modi posted on X.
He further said that the Haryana government would leave “no stone unturned” to fulfil the hopes and aspirations of the people.
“This victory is an expression of the unwavering faith of the people in the development work being carried out by the government led by Nayab Singh Saini in the state. I assure the people of the state that we will leave no stone unturned to fulfil their hopes and aspirations,” the PM added.
He also thanked the BJP workers and said, “The hard work of the dedicated workers of the party has played a big role in this great victory, for which I heartily appreciate them.”

The BJP in Haryana has swept the elections to local bodies, with its candidates winning mayoral posts in nine places, including Rohtak, Sonipat, Gurugram, Faridabad, Panipat, Yamunanagar, Ambala, Hisar and Karnal. The voting took place on March 2.
According to the Haryana Election Commission website, BJP leader Shelja Sandeep Sachdeva won the mayoral post from Ambala and defeated Congress’ Amisha Chawla by a margin of 20,487 votes.
BJP’s Ram Avtar won the Rohtak mayoral post and defeated Congress’ Surajmal Kiloi by 45,198 votes.
From Sonipat, BJP won the mayoral post, with its candidate Rajeev Jain winning against Congress’ Kamal Dewan by a margin of 34,749 votes.
BJP leader Tilak Raj won the mayoral post from Gurugram and defeated Congress’ Seema Pahuja with a margin of 1,79,485 votes. Meanwhile, from Panipat, BJP’s Komal Saini defeated Congress leader Sanjay Kumar by a margin of 1,23,170 votes.
BJP leader Suman Bahmani won the mayoral post from Yamunanagar and defeated Congress’ Kirna Devi by 73,319 votes.
Meanwhile, from Karnal, BJP’s Renu Bala Gupta won the mayoral post and defeated Congress leader Manoj Wadhwa.
The Haryana Election Commission website declared Parveen Joshi of the BJP the winner of the mayoral post from Faridabad. She defeated Congress’ Lata Rani by a margin of 3,16,852 votes.
From Hisar, BJP leader Parveen Popli won the mayoral post by defeating Congress’ Krishna Titu Singla with a margin of 64,456 votes. (ANI)
